site stats

Google swiss table

Web2 days ago · Live from Dart Bar WebAll groups and messages ... ...

abseil / Swiss Tables and absl::Hash

WebCollectively, these hash tables are known as “Swiss tables” and are designed to be replacements for std::unordered_map and std::unordered_set They provide several advantages over the std::unordered_* containers: Provides C++14 support for C++17 mechanisms such as try_emplace(). Supports heterogeneous lookup. WebMar 7, 2024 · This is not an officially supported Google product. About. No description or website provided. Topics. benchmarks hashtable Resources. Readme License. Apache-2.0 license Code of conduct. Code of conduct Security policy. Security policy Stars. 96 stars Watchers. 14 watching Forks. 24 forks Report repository frenches court seaford https://vapenotik.com

Swiss Tables and absl::Hash : cpp - Reddit

WebGet the latest Swiss Market Index (SMI) value, historical performance, charts, and other financial information to help you make more informed trading and investment decisions. WebCreate a table. When you first access Tables, you’ll land on the Homepage where you can see recent workspaces and tables you’ve worked with. Click on the “ + New ” fab button … WebSwiss table的关键设计就是——通过相邻地址法来解决hash冲突。一个平坦的内存结构,能够提高cpu cache命中率。 因此,具体的设计细节,都是针对相邻地址法解决hash冲突的具体办法。 大致结构. swiss hash的大致结 … frenches chilio

Destinations and connections worlwide - Swissair

Category:Tables A Business Workflow Management Automation Tool

Tags:Google swiss table

Google swiss table

GitHub - nakaji-dayo/hs-swisstable: Haskell implementation of Google…

WebOct 15, 2024 · Accessing Abseil Swiss Tables from C. This is a tiny wrapper library allowing C code to use Swiss Tables, Google's state-of-the-art hash table implementation. … WebThe Swiss table uses the fact that some processors can perform multiple operations in parallel with a single instruction to speed up a linear probing table. Extendible hashing is …

Google swiss table

Did you know?

WebVisit ESPN to view the 2024-22 Swiss Super League Table. ... Swiss side FC Sion sacked nine first-team players on Wednesday after they refused to take a pay cut due to the coronavirus outbreak. 3Y; Web6. level 2. · 3 yr. ago Jon Cohen Abseil. One thing which is nice about the Abseil tables in particular is absl::Hash. It will create arbitrary hash functions for you which have strong mixing properties. A bad hash function will ruin the performance of any hash table and SwissTable makes it hard to do that. 10.

Web2 Turning the feature on. If you upload your data in this format and go to step 3: Visualize, your table will display the flag codes instead of the flag icons. We need to turn this feature on so that Datawrapper knows that we want to see flag icons. To do so, go to the Refine tab and select all the columns with flag codes (press Shift to select ... WebJan 7, 2024 · Hello masters, For now I try to figure out but maybe someone has already the answer; I want to use excel to pair chess players using swiss system for tournament, in my case it will be maximum 30 players (player1, player2...), in first round they will be randomly paired, then rules are as below: Winner : +1 point. Draw: 0.5 points both.

Webwhere the values passed should provide coverage for all interesting states of the object. For more complex cases, please see Testing Your Custom AbslHashValue Implementation below. Using absl::Hash. The absl::Hash framework is the default hash implementation for the “Swiss table” hash tables. All types hashable by the absl::Hash framework will … WebSwiss tables; Design Notes. A lot of design work has gone into the code we’re releasing within the Abseil codebase. We’ll be sharing several of our design decisions here, and we’ll be adding more design notes in the future. absl::Mutex Pre-adopted std:: types absl::StrFormat Swiss tables

WebGet about easily with children. Information about train travel with children, pushchairs and luggage. Plus tips on tickets, entertainment, days out and holidays. Because good planning is the key to a good journey. More information.

WebUse Google Sheets to create and edit online spreadsheets. Get insights together with secure sharing in real-time and from any device. frenches chip shopSwiss tables hold a densely packed array of metadata, containing presenceinformation for entries in the table. This presence information allows us tooptimize both lookup and insertion operations. This metadata adds one byte ofoverhead for every entry in the table. See more In addition to optimizations made in relation to element insertion and lookup,Swiss tables were designed to also optimize certain operations that wereespecially non … See more NOTE: The design and implementation of Swiss tables involved many people, butin particular, we’d like to acknowledge the major contributions (in alphabeticalorder) ofSam … See more frenches creekWebApr 5, 2024 · Then you clink glasses with everyone again, repeating Step 1. Wait for host to say "en guete" before touching any food. The same rules apply for dessert wine, or any time the alcohol has changed or a new eating phase has begun. To indicate you want more food, leave the cutlery on the plate. frenches creek qldWebhashbrown. This crate is a Rust port of Google's high-performance SwissTable hash map, adapted to make it a drop-in replacement for Rust's standard HashMap and HashSet types.. The original C++ version of SwissTable can be found here, and this CppCon talk gives an overview of how the algorithm works.. Since Rust 1.36, this is now the HashMap … fast food in north koreaWebNov 21, 2024 · Competing with Google's Swiss Table and Facebook's F14. Microdict's underlying C implementation was benchmarked against Swiss Table->abseil::flat_hash_map and F14->folly::F14FastMap to further test its capabilities. The data types were set as above using the same settings. The following tables show the results … fast food in oakdale mnWebSep 27, 2024 · We are extremely pleased to announce the availability of the new “Swiss Table” family of hashtables in Abseil and the absl::Hash hashing framework that allows … fast food in north branch mnWebFeb 16, 2024 · cwisstable is a single-header C11 port of the Abseil project's SwissTables . This project is intended to bring the proven performance and flexibility of SwissTables to C projects which cannot require a C++ compiler or for projects which otherwise struggle with dependency management. The public API is currently in flux, as is test coverage, but ... frenches cremation